Factors Influencing Accuracy

The design of a customized collet chuck is fundamental to its functionality. A well-engineered chuck will provide uniform clamping pressure across the workpiece, crucial for maintaining consistent machining tolerances. When designing a collet chuck, consider factors like the number of segments, taper angles, and gripping surfaces. A collet with more gripping segments typically offers better flexibility and holds the workpiece more securely, increasing overall accuracy.

Material selection also plays an integral role in customized collet chuck accuracy. High-quality materials, such as alloy steel or specialized composites, enhance durability while reducing thermal expansion and deformation during machining processes. Investing in superior materials not only improves accuracy but also prolongs the lifecycle of the tooling system.

Manufacturing tolerances are a critical consideration in achieving enhanced customized collet chuck accuracy. Precision machining techniques like CNC milling and grinding can ensure that elements are produced within stringent tolerances. Collaborating with manufacturers known for their rigorous quality controls ensures that the customized collet chucks will deliver the level of accuracy required in demanding production environments.

Improvement Strategies

To further enhance customized collet chuck accuracy, consider implementing routine maintenance checks as part of standard operating procedures. Regular inspections can help identify wear and tear or misalignments that could compromise accuracy over time. Additionally, cleaning the collet chuck and its components prevents debris accumulation, ensuring optimal performance.

Employing advanced tooling technology can also contribute to improved accuracy. Utilizing tool path optimization software can help identify the best cutting strategies and speeds for specific applications. When combined with high-precision customized collet chucks, these technologies create a synergistic effect that leads to better overall machining results.

Moreover, education and training for operators on the proper use of customized collet chucks can lead to significant accuracy improvements. Well-trained staff will be more adept at setting up machinery and troubleshooting issues as they arise, ultimately enhancing the efficiency of manufacturing processes.
